Bibury, Gloucestershire is a short drive away from Northleach. It is an excellent place to travel from if you're looking to visit the popular towns of Cirencester and Stow-on-the-Wold. Northleach was at one time an important market town, celebrated throughout Europe as a major centre for the Cotswold wool trade! The fifteenth-century church of St Peter and St Paul, paid for by the wealthy wool merchants, was built with stone dug from the quarry in the town itself and what is now the Market Square.
